[Ifeffit] Core-hole Lifetimes in Hephaestus 0.9.26

Matt Newville newville at cars.uchicago.edu
Mon Sep 28 13:37:05 CDT 2020


I believe it is using (or intends to use)

    lifetime = hbar /gamma

which is what Krause et al give.  With gamma = 0.2 eV, and hbar ~=
4.13567e-15 eVs, then lifetime is ~20fs.
Maybe I'm missing something more subtle?  FWIW, these reported numbers for
gamma in eV are described by Krause et al as "FWHM".

> The widths in energy (eV) are fine.
>
> However, in "Hephaestus", the "souped-up periodic table for the X-ray
> absorption spectroscopist", these level widths in energy (eV) are also
> given as equivalent lifetimes (in fs), however incorrectly: A level width
> of ~0.2 eV in fact corresponds to a lifetime of ca. 3 fs, not ~30 fs as
> given there.
>
> Those lifetimes shown in Hephaestus all seem to be off by a general factor
> of 10. I guess that is just the energy width/lifetime conversion gone
> slightly wrong...
> I imagine I'm not the only one using Hephaestus as a convenient tool to
> look stuff up quickly, so I thought it might be useful to point out this
> flaw.
>
> Just to make sure, I have again imported the xraydb: That has not changed
> Hephaestus' behavior in terms of the lifetime info (I'm using the latest
> 64-bit version on Windows).

> > Thanks - that does seem wrong.  FWIW, Larch uses XrayDB which uses
> > corehole
> > widths from Krause and Oliver for Z>10 and Keski-Rahkoken nand Krause for
> > Z<10.
> > For the F K edge, this give 0.2089 eV.  For this or other core-hole
> > widths,
> > and assuming you have Python installed, try:
> >
> >   ~> pip install xraydb
> >   ~> python
> >   >>> import xraydb
> >   >>> xraydb.core_width('F', 'K')
> >   0.2089
> >
> > Or install Larch and use
> >
> >    ~> larch
> >    larch> core_width('F', 'K')
> >    0.2089

> >> To Whom it may concern,
> >>
> >> I am quite sure there is a general lifetime/energy-width conversion
> >> error
> >> in Hephaestus: All core-hole lifetimes seem to come out too long by a
> >> factor of - as it seems exactly - 10:
> >> E.g. the lifetime of the F K-edge with a width of 0.25 eV is given as
> >> 25.30 fs instead of ca. 2.6 fs (width = h_bar / lifetime).
> >>
> >> This glitch was present in 0.9.25 already and, as I noticed after
> >> updating, prevails in 0.9.26. I have not tried earlier versions.
